Do exhaust tips increase HP?

Exhaust tips do not directly increase horsepower (HP) in a vehicle. The main function of exhaust tips is to improve the aesthetic appearance of the vehicle and to change the sound of the exhaust. However, certain aftermarket exhaust systems can increase horsepower by reducing backpressure and allowing the engine to breathe more easily, which can result in improved performance. But, the exhaust tips are not responsible for the horsepower increase, it is the exhaust system that is responsible for horsepower increase. Do exhaust tips affect the sound?

Exhaust tips can affect the sound of a vehicle’s exhaust system. The shape, size and material of the exhaust tips can change the way the exhaust gases exit the vehicle, which can affect the tone, volume and resonance of the sound. Larger diameter tips can amplify the sound of the exhaust, making it louder and deeper.

Conversely, smaller diameter tips can dampen the sound and make it quieter. Some exhaust tips are also designed to change the direction of the exhaust gases, which can change the direction of the sound and the way it is perceived. So, exhaust tips can play a role in modifying the sound of the exhaust but it is not the only factor.

How can I make my exhaust sound deeper?

Here are a few ways to make your exhaust sound deeper:

  1. Install a larger diameter exhaust: Larger diameter exhaust pipes allow for more exhaust gases to flow through, which can create a deeper, more aggressive sound.
  2. Install a low-restriction muffler: A low-restriction muffler allows for more exhaust gases to flow through, which can also create a deeper, more aggressive sound.
  3. Install a performance exhaust system: Aftermarket performance exhaust systems often feature larger diameter pipes and low-restriction mufflers, which can create a deeper, more aggressive sound.
  4. Install a resonator delete: A resonator is a component that helps to dampen the sound of the exhaust. Removing it can make the exhaust louder and deeper.
  5. Change the angle of the exhaust tips: Changing the angle of the exhaust tips can change the direction of the sound and make it more pronounced.
